Visualizing the Unseen: 4D Representations
Delving into the realm of four dimensions presents a formidable challenge for our intuitive comprehension. We are inherently confined to a three-dimensional perspective, making it difficult to grasp concepts that extend beyond our familiar framework. However, mathematicians and scientists have developed ingenious methods to represent these unseen dimensions, often employing abstractions that shed light on the structures of 4D objects.
- Consider, a cube can be readily perceived in three dimensions. But its 4D analog, known as a hypercube or tesseract, defies our standard visual representation.
- Thus, mathematicians often utilize projections and cross-sections to display the hidden dimensions of a tesseract. These projections, though approximate, offer valuable insights into its essence.
Similarly, phenomena in physics, such as spacetime, can be best explored through a 4D lens. Adding the dimension of time, physicists can analyze events and interactions that transcend our three-dimensional experience.
